More and more couples are finding it difficult to conceive a child. The first step in identifying and treating this problem is often a fertility test for women. This article provides an in-depth overview of what a female fertility test is, the different types of test available, and how they can help identify various problems.
Fertility Test Woman
A female fertility test is a series of medical examinations designed to assess various reproductive and hormonal functions. The aim is to detect abnormalities that could prevent natural conception. These examinations take into account several elements such as hormones, ovulation, the structure of the reproductive organs and much more.
Hormones play a crucial role in fertility. Here are the main hormones analysed during a fertility test:
The pituitary gland plays a central role in regulating menstrual cycles by secreting various hormones. A problem with this gland can lead to hormonal imbalances, making it difficult to conceive.
A hormone test consists of a series of blood tests to measure precise hormone levels. FSH and LH levels are often checked between the second and fifth day of the menstrual cycle, while progesterone is generally measured about a week after presumed ovulation.
Testing forovulation is essential for any fertility assessment. Predictive ovulation tests are often used, which measure the peak of LH in the urine, indicating that ovulation is imminent.
A pelvic examination enables the anatomical structure of the reproductive organs to be analysed. A transvaginal ultrasound is frequently used to visualise the ovaries and endometrium, enabling abnormalities such as cysts or fibroids to be detected.
Ovarian reserve represents the number and quality of oocytes present in the ovaries. The ovarian reserve test usually includes an analysis of anti-mullerian hormone (AMH) and an ultrasound count of the antral follicles.
This X-ray examination checks the patency of the fallopian tubes and the shape of the uterine cavity. It consists of injecting a contrast product into the uterus and then taking X-ray images to detect obstructions or structural anomalies.
In certain complex cases, an internal visual study is necessary. Laparoscopy involves inserting a thin camera through a small abdominal incision, giving a direct view of the ovaries, fallopian tubes and the outside of the uterus.
This procedure involves collecting a small sample of the uterine lining for analysis. This is used to check whether the endometrium conforms to its typical characteristics during the menstrual cycle and to identify any histological abnormalities.
Each hormone value has specific normal ranges depending on the period of the menstrual cycle at which it is measured. For example, an elevated FSH may indicate a decrease in ovarian reserve, while a low progesterone level could mean impaired ovulation.
Ultrasound and HSG findings may reveal physical abnormalities such as fibroids, polyps or adhesions that can complicate conception. Laparoscopy can add further detail by identifying conditions such as endometriosis.
A low number of antral follicles or a low AMH level indicates a low ovarian reserve. This often requires rapid and specific intervention to increase the chances of pregnancy.
Once all the results have been collected and studied, it makes sense to consult a fertility specialist. He or she will be able to recommend treatments or techniques tailored to each individual situation.

Age is a critical factor that strongly influences a woman’s fertility. As women age, the quantity and quality of their oocytes decline. This reduction is particularly noticeable after the age of 35.
Certain medical conditions such as chronic illnesses, infections and surgical procedures can also have a negative impact on fertility. Lifestyle factors such as stress, body weight, smoking and alcohol consumption can also play an important role.
The impact of genetic factors cannot be underestimated. The presence of certain chromosomal abnormalities can impair fertility or cause repeated miscarriages.
